// Fixture: orphan-sweeper-dryrun
// Seeds three detached volumes and one dangling snapshot in the Fernwick
// staging cluster, then asserts the sweeper tags them within two cycles.
// Do NOT run against prod-mirror; the sweeper there deletes, not tags.
// If the sweep count drifts, check the Larkspur reconciler queue first —
// it backs up after every Tuesday deploy and skews the fixture counts.
// The sweeper API requires auth even in staging. Use the bearer token below when invoking the sweep endpoint manually.

login token, tawef-tagug: eyJhbGciOiJIUzI1NiIsInR5cCI6IkpXVCJ9.eyJzdWIiOiImnQ4jL-W8UIn0.KdAQM80K7A_k

Hi support crew,

Quick heads-up: ownership of the Quillgate plugin system for data validators is changing hands starting Monday. That covers third-party validator packs, the schema-check sandbox, and those "plugin failed to load" tickets that keep landing in your queue. Escalation flow stays the same — tag the ticket with `validators` and it'll route correctly. The old rotation alias is being retired, so please update your macros. Going forward, all plugin-related escalations should be directed to the new owner.

account owner for kafop-haweg: Pelax Gilael Istir

Handing off the Quillbus broker upgrade (4.x to 5.1) to Dario. Cluster is half-migrated; mixed-version mode is supported but TLS cert rotation must finish before cutover. No auth model changes, though the admin API gained two new endpoints worth reviewing. Open questions and the migration checklist are tracked on the internal page below.

dashboard of taduf-bawef = https://jira.lumicsys.internal/projects/display/browse/b1cbf89d

Facilities Ticket — Cleaning Crew Access, Brindle Annex

For new starters handling evening lock-up: the Sorano Cleaning crew arrives nightly at 21:30 via the annex side door. Check their rota sheet, note arrival in the log, and ensure the storeroom is relocked afterward. To let them through the side door, enter the access code below.

badge for yaweg-hafog: bdg-GX-6